How can I manage push notifications?

Please be aware, push notifications are only available on a mobile device with the U.S. Bank Mobile App installed and the appropriate permissions are allowed.

After you've logged into the mobile app:

  1. From the main menu, select Notifications.
  2. Then choose Insights & Updates.
  3. Use the toggle switch next to Allow push notifications to turn them on or off.

Notifications include:

  • A deposit posted to your account.
  • Duplicate charges, transfers, and/or withdrawals
  • A duplicate purchase, charge or other transaction was made to or from your account
  • A check you wrote or deposited was returned
  • Your account is overdrawn
  • A credit card payment is past due
  • An important document was returned to us
